Link your accounts

How it works

Do you have a City savings account or a second checking account? We can link your accounts so that if you happen to overdraw your checking account and funds are available in your linked account, we will automatically transfer funds from one account to the other.

What it covers

  • Checks and ACH Transactions
  • ATM and One-Time to Non-Recurring Debit Card Transactions
  • Recurring Debit Card Transactions

What it costs

  • No charge per transfer
  • A $36 overdraft fee will apply if funds are not available in the linked account to cover an overdraft.
  • A $1.50 fee will apply for each transaction in excess of 3 per month
  • Savings accounts are limited to a total of 6 transactions per month.

Overdraft line of credit *

How it works

You may apply for a line of credit. Once approved, if you overdraw your account and funds are available, we will automatically transfer funds from your credit line into your checking account, up to your credit limit.

What it covers

  • Checks and ACH Transactions
  • ATM and One-Time to Non-Recurring Debit Card Transactions
  • Recurring Debit Card Transactions

What it costs

  • $25 Annual Fee, plus interest on the amount of the line you use

Bounce Protection **

How it works

If you write a check or make recurring payments and sufficient funds are not available in your account, City will strive to pay the item(s). This can help you avoid costly returned check fees from merchants.

What it covers

  • Checks and ACH Transactions
  • Recurring Debit Card Transactions

What it costs

  • If you have a transaction that causes an overdraft, you'll be charged $36 per overdraft whether the item is paid or returned.

Qualifying accounts will automatically be enrolled. You can opt-out at any point using one of the methods below.

Bounce Protection Plus **

How it works

If you attempt a debit card transaction or an ATM withdrawal and sufficient funds are not available in your account, City will strive to authorize and pay the transaction.

What it covers

  • ATM and One-Time to Non-Recurring Debit Card Transactions

What it costs

  • If you complete a transaction that causes an overdraft, you'll be charged $36 per overdraft.

This feature is available on your account only if you opt-in. You can opt-in or opt-out at any time using one of the methods below.

What happens if I don't have any overdraft protection services?

Please know that we understand that mistakes happen. Sometimes you might write a check or initiate another transaction without having enough money in your account. At City, we'll waive the fees for the first two non-sufficient funds (NSF) items you incur during the life of your account. Beyond that, NSF items will be treated as follows:

If you write a check or make a recurring payment for more money than you have in your account, City will return the item unpaid and a $36 NSF fee will be assessed against your account.

If you attempt to make a debit card purchase or ATM withdrawal for more money than you have in your account, the transaction will be declined and no fee will be assessed.

**Customer Overdraft Policy. Not available on Bounce Back checking accounts or accounts enrolled in the Fresh Start repayment plan. An insufficient balance could result from 1) the payment of checks, electronic funds transfers, or other withdrawal requests; 2) payments authorized by you; 3) the return of unpaid items deposited by you; 4) the imposition of bank service charges; or 5) the deposit of items which, according to the bank’s Funds Availability Policy, are treated as not yet available or finally paid. Overdrafts are paid at the bank’s discretion and we reserve the right not to pay. However, if you maintain your account in good standing (defined as making regular deposits and bringing your account to a positive balance at least once every 30 days), and there are no legal orders outstanding, we may approve reasonable overdrafts as a non-contractual courtesy. The NSF fee(s) of $36 for each NSF item will be imposed when covering overdrafts created by check, in-person withdrawal, ATM withdrawal or other electronic means. You may opt out of the privilege at any time, but you are responsible for any overdrawn balances at the time of opting out. Normally, we will not approve an overdraft for you in excess of the pre-determined amount assigned to your account type, which includes the NSF fee(s) of $36 charged for each NSF item.

We may refuse to pay an NSF item for you at any time, even though we may have previously paid NSF items for you. You will be notified by mail of any NSF items paid or returned that you may have, however, we have no obligation to notify you before we pay or return any item. The amount of any overdraft plus NSF fee you owe us shall be due and payable upon demand. If there is an NSF item paid by us on an account with more than one owner on the signature card, each owner and agent, if applicable, drawing/presenting the item creating the overdraft, shall be jointly and severally liable for such overdraft plus our NSF fee.

You should note that Bounce Protection will not be included in your available balance provided by a teller, on your ATM receipt or through City National Bank’s online or 24-hour telephone banking systems; however, you will have access for withdrawal purposes through the ATM.
